Bishop Road Community Choir
Bishop Road Community Choir is open to all in The local community.

We are a mixed, non-audition choir. All songs are taught by ear and we don’t expect anyone to learn The words off by heart. However, music can be made available for those who want it. We sing a range of different songs, including Pop, gospel, world music and classical. We mainly sing songs with piano accompaniment, provided by our famous pianist, Geoff. We hold our own annual concert, and we are often invited to sing at oTher local events such as The local MayFest.
Our members come along for “enjoyment, friendship and satisfaction as well as singing with a group of like-minded people”.
Singing is reputed to release endorphins in The brain, and we’ve certainly noticed amongst us a sense of well-being following rehearsals and in particular, concerts. We are a very sociable bunch and often meet for a drink at The Chimp House on Gloucester Road following our rehearsal on Thursday evenings.

Die Hoërskool Wonderboom Skoolkoor
The choir was founded in 1986 by Mr. Albert Morland who has since held The reigns in his very capable conducting hands. During this time The choir has achieved success on many levels: Locally They have received 10 golden diplomas on provincial level for The “ATKV Applous” competition in The category for advanced, mixed high school choirs; and 7 golden diplomas on national level for The same competition. They were The only choir in The History of The Director’s trophy who won The award 8 times and They were also The first to do so in all three categories: mixed- (5 times), boys’- (twice) and girls’ choir (once). They have also received double gold at The Gauteng Eisteddfod, A and A+ awards at The Pretoria Beeld Eisteddfod and first place in Their category in more than one local competition. They have annual workshops and master classes with well-known and respected conductors (both locally and internationally) and have hosted many international choirs and groups. Coastal Sound Children's Choir

Coastal Sound Children’s Choir aims to inspire each young singer to be Their best–as musicians and as contributing engaged citizens–through choral singing.
Under The direction of Diana Clark since 2009, Children’s Choir consists of caring young musicians from diverse cultural heritages, ages 9-15 years old. Storytelling, joy of singing, connection and flexibility of performance are The core values of this group. The choir also loves to work with guest conductors and share with oTher choirs. They have recently been guest singers with Vancouver Chamber Choir.
Since 1989, when Donna Otto founded The group, Coastal Sound Children’s Choir has performed at important cultural events in Greater Vancouver and Whistler, has toured extensively throughout The world, and has co-hosted The Coastal Sound International Choral Festival.

Komorni zbor Orfej Ljutomer

was formed in 1989. The choir's permanent artistic director is Romana Rek. In The past years, Chamber choir Orfej has received a number of awards, which places Them among The more prominent Slovenian choirs. Orfej has proven its high level of vocal performance in April 2010 at The prestigious Slovene national choir competition ‘Naša Pesem’ (i. e. ‘Our Song’). The choir scored 93 points, received The gold award, and The second prize in The category ‘mixed choirs’.
